Why Upgrade Your Stock Harley-Davidson Speakers?
Harley-Davidson motorcycles have been built for long rides and strong performance, ever since the company’s founding in 1903.
But the stock audio systems in these motorcycles don’t always match the same standard. Factory speakers are limited in power handling, which means they distort or fade out when you try to push the volume higher. On the highway, this makes it difficult to hear music clearly over wind, pipes, and road noise.
Upgrading your speakers changes that. Aftermarket Harley speaker upgrade kits are designed with higher efficiency, better materials, and stronger power handling. The result is audio that cuts through at speed without losing clarity. Riders also benefit from improved bass response, which stock speakers simply can’t deliver.
Durability is another factor. Quality aftermarket speakers are built with weather-resistant components to handle rain, sun, and vibration — conditions that take a toll on factory setups over time. With a proper upgrade, you get sound that lasts and performance that holds up mile after mile.

Power Handling and Efficiency
Motorcycle audio systems rely on speakers that can handle higher volumes without distortion. Look for speakers with strong power handling and sensitivity ratings that make the most of your amplifier setup. This is especially important if you’re aiming for the best Harley audio upgrade.
Weather and Vibration Resistance
Unlike car speakers, motorcycle speakers are exposed to rain, sun, and constant vibration. High-quality aftermarket speakers use durable cones, surrounds, and coatings that protect against these elements. This ensures consistent sound quality and a longer lifespan.
Fit and Compatibility
Different Harley-Davidson models use different speaker sizes—most commonly 5.25", 6.5", or 6x9". Choosing speakers designed specifically for your bike, or complete Harley speaker upgrade kits, eliminates installation issues and ensures a clean fit inside factory fairings.
Ease of Installation
Many aftermarket speakers are designed as direct replacements for Harley factory speakers. This makes the upgrade process straightforward, saving time and avoiding the need for custom modifications.

Speaker Size and Placement
- 5.25" speakers are commonly found in older Harley fairings.
- 6.5" speakers are the most popular size for modern models, offering a strong balance of clarity and bass.
- 6x9" speakers deliver maximum output and deeper low-end response, often used in saddlebag lids for full coverage.
-
Amplifier Pairing
- Upgraded speakers perform best with a matched amplifier. This ensures clean power delivery and higher volume without distortion.

How to make motorcycle speakers sound better?
The quickest way to improve sound is by upgrading to aftermarket speakers built for motorcycle use. Adding an amplifier provides clean power, which allows your speakers to perform at higher volumes without distortion. Proper installation and tuning also play a big role in sound quality.
How many watts should motorcycle speakers be?
Most high-performance motorcycle speakers are rated between 100 and 200 watts RMS. Pairing them with the right amplifier ensures you get the full benefit of that power. Higher wattage ratings give you more headroom, meaning louder sound with less strain.
Can you upgrade Harley speakers without adding an amplifier?
Yes, but the improvement will be limited. Replacing stock speakers alone will provide better clarity, but adding an amplifier is the step that unlocks the full potential of a Harley speaker upgrade.
Are Harley speaker upgrades waterproof or weather-resistant?
Aftermarket motorcycle speakers are designed with weather-resistant materials to handle rain, UV exposure, and vibration. This durability is essential for long-term reliability and consistent performance.
